NEW First Edition hardcover (Orig. 2010) First Printing * 6.28" x 9.50" x 2.24", 1.58 kg, xxxii+1104 (1136) pp * ABOUT THE BOOK: At his death in 1994, Ralph Ellison left behind roughly 2,000 pp of his unfinished 2nd novel, which he had spent nearly 4 decades writing. Long awaited, it was to have been the work Ellison intended to follow his masterpiece, "Invisible Man". Five years later, Random House published "Juneteenth", drawn from the central narrative of Ellison's unfinished epic. "Three Days Before the Shooting" gathers together in one volume, for the first time, all the parts of that planned opus, including 3 major sequences never before published. Set in the frame of a deathbed vigil, the story is a gripping multi-generational saga centered on the assassination of the controversial, race-baiting U.S. senator Adam Sunraider, who's being tended to by "Daddy" Hickman, the elderly black jazz musician turned preacher who raised the orphan Sunraider as a light-skinned black in rural Georgia. Presented in their unexpurgated, provisional state, the narrative sequences form a deeply poetic, moving, & profoundly entertaining book, brimming w/ humor & tension, composed in Ellison's magical jazz-inspired prose style & marked by his incomparable ear for vernacular speech. Beyond its richly compelling narratives, "Three Days Before the Shooting ." is perhaps most notable for its extraordinary insight into the creative process of one of this country's greatest writers. In various stages of composition and revision, its typescripts and computer files testify to Ellison's achievement and struggle with his material from the mid-1950s until his death forty years later.
